★ 5★ 4★ 3★ 2★ 1Stopped by Nonna’s Kitchen Bar for a quick breakfast just before 6:00 AM, and I was pleasantly surprised.Unlike other spots in the terminal that either weren’t ready or didn’t have a chef yet, Nonna’s Kitchen was up and running early. No delays, no excuses — just service.The place is clean, conveniently located near the gates, and the staff moved fast. Coffee was served almost immediately, with free refills — a big plus for early travelers.My breakfast ("build your own omelet") was ready in about 5 minutes. The eggs were cooked well, and it came with a fresh side salad dressed in a light lime vinaigrette — simple, fresh, and satisfying.I had checked the reviews beforehand and noticed they weren’t particularly high, but my experience was different. Maybe it was because it was early in the morning and the team was fresh on their shift, but I really did get my food fast.Quick, clean, and efficient — exactly what I needed to start a travel day right.Recommended for anyone catching an early flight out of Terminal C.

May 21 · Michaelangelo VillaOrdered the classic breakfast with chicken sausages, fried eggs, potatoes and coffee. Their potatoes are thin cut, fried with green onions, so crispy and delicious. Very strong coffee. Large and clean dining environment.
